Comparing single-phase vs. three-phase power, three-phase power supplies are more efficient. A three-phase power supply can transmit three times as much power as a single-phase power supply, while only needing one additional wire (that is, three wires instead of two).

What is the advantage of three-phase motor that a single-phase motor?

In general, three phase motors present a better efficiency and power factor than a single phase motor and they are also more reliable, lighter and require less maintenance, as no capacitor or internal switches are needed.

When would a 3-phase motor be used?

Applications of 3-Phase Wound-Rotor Induction Motor They are used for loads that requires speed control. Typical applications of wound rotor or slip ring induction motors are crushers, plunger pumps, cranes & hoists, elevators, compressors and conveyors.

Why single-phase is used in homes?

Single-phase connections are intended for domestic supplies and residential homes. That's because, most of the appliances require a small amount of electricity to perform such as television, lights, fans, refrigerator, etc. The functioning of a single-phase connection is simple and ordinary.

Is 3-phase cheaper than single phase?

Single phase power is used in most homes and small businesses because it is relatively simple and inexpensive to install. Commercial and industrial businesses with greater electricity needs prefer three phase power because it is more efficient and less expensive to operate.

How can you tell if a motor is 3-phase?

First, you can check the motor nameplate data which is usually located on a paper or metal label attached to the side of the motor. Second you can simply look at the number of electrical leads coming out of the motor. If your motor has three black leads and a green lead then it is likely three phase.

What voltage is a 3-phase motor?

A common supply voltage is 120V/208V 3 phase Wye configuration. 120 volts is measured from each phase to neutral (neutral is center-tapped) and 208 volts is measured phase to phase.

Which phase is best for home?

Single phase is best for homes where the largest electrical load comes from something like a dryer and an electric range. Three phase power is superior when multiple appliances or electrical devices are being used and where power consumption performance is important.

What is the maximum power for single phase?

There is a limit to the load that a single phase can handle and typically that number is set to 7.5 kW (or 7500 watts or 10 Horse Power) (but varies from state to state). So if the sum of wattage of all the appliances that you are running at a time is more than 7.5 kW, then you need a three-phase connection.
